Mastering Data Lakes: Storing and Analyzing Big Data Efficiently


In today’s data-driven world, organizations are grappling with the challenges of storing and analyzing vast amounts of data efficiently. Data lakes have emerged as a powerful solution to these challenges, allowing businesses to harness the true potential of big data.

What is a Data Lake?

A data lake is a centralized repository that allows you to store all your structured and unstructured data at any scale. Unlike traditional databases that require data to be processed and organized before storage, a data lake can hold raw data in its native format until it is needed for analysis.

Key Features of Data Lakes

  • Scalability: Data lakes can grow exponentially to accommodate ever-increasing data volumes.
  • Variety: They support a wide range of data types, from text and images to videos and log files.
  • Accessibility: Data stored in a data lake can be accessed by various tools and frameworks for analysis.
  • Cost-Effectiveness: Using less expensive storage solutions compared to traditional databases enables cost savings.

Benefits of Using a Data Lake

Organizations can realize several benefits by implementing a data lake:

  • Improved Decision-Making: By leveraging a comprehensive data set, companies can make informed decisions based on insights derived from their data.
  • Enhanced Analytics: With advanced analytics tools, businesses can analyze raw data to uncover trends and patterns.
  • Faster Time to Insights: Data lakes eliminate the time-consuming process of data preprocessing, allowing for quicker analysis.

Best Practices for Mastering Data Lakes

To maximize the effectiveness of your data lake, consider the following best practices:

  • Data Governance: Establish clear policies for data access, quality, and security to ensure compliance and integrity.
  • Metadata Management: Use metadata to organize and categorize data, making it easier to find and analyze.
  • Choose the Right Tools: Leverage the right frameworks and tools (like Apache Spark, Hadoop, etc.) for efficient data processing and analysis.
  • Regular Maintenance: Continuously monitor and maintain your data lake to optimize performance and storage costs.

Future of Data Lakes

The future of data lakes looks promising as more organizations adopt big data strategies. Integrated AI and machine learning technologies will further enhance the analysis capabilities of data lakes, enabling predictive analytics and real-time data processing.

Conclusion

As businesses continue to generate and collect data at unprecedented rates, mastering data lakes will be essential in efficiently storing and analyzing big data. By understanding their functionality, benefits, and best practices, organizations can unlock valuable insights to drive innovation and growth.

Leave a Reply

Your email address will not be published. Required fields are marked *

Enquire now

Give us a call or fill in the form below and we will contact you. We endeavor to answer all inquiries within 24 hours on business days.